A modern Chinese type which contains a subjective object is a secondary sort of Subject-Predicate predicative type. In this dissertation the author surveyed approximate 500 examples through lots of linguistic facts according to the three-plane theory tried to explore the modern Chinese type on the basis of the forerunners' research results in the angles of syntax, semantics, pragmatics to grasp the sentence type completely.The main body includes three sections: In the first section syntactic analyses were made to explore the structure system, structure order and homomorphic discrimination; In the second section semantic analyses were made to explore and analyze the Ill-types, semantic valence and the case of nouns, especially the 8 sorts of Ill-types in details; In the third section pragmatic analyses were made to explore the subjective part and predicative part, expressive focus, tone, omission and hidden forms etc.
